Whitefish Done at State Basketball Tourney

By Beacon Staff

The Whitefish Bulldogs fell to Butte Central 67-52 in a loser-out game at the State Class A Boys Basketball Tournament on Friday afternoon. The Bulldogs’ season is over.

Whitefish lost to Dillon 48-42 in the first round on Thursday night to set up the game with Butte Central. The loss to Central ends the high school careers of seven seniors for Whitefish, including Colt Idol, a 6-foot-3 lefty who has committed to play at Montana State University next year.

Northwestern A still has one team left in the tourney. Columbia Falls plays in a semifinal matchup at 6:30 p.m. on Friday night against defending state champion Browning.
